    Apple Upgrade Program Lease Explained

    The Apple Upgrade Program allows customers to finance an iPhone through monthly payments that include device insurance and the option to upgrade annually. Rather than owning the hardware outright, participants essentially rent the device, returning it to Apple at the end of each cycle. This model integrates with Apple’s broader services layer, including iCloud storage and App Store subscriptions, creating a continuous revenue stream tied to IT infrastructure demands.

    The Mechanics Behind App Disabling

    Apple’s App Store relies on cloud-based payment gateways and account management servers to monitor recurring billing. When a payment fails, the system can revoke app entitlements stored in user profiles, effectively locking functionality without direct user intervention. This process ties into broader data center operations that handle real-time transaction verification across global networks.

    Enforcement Technology And Verification Systems

    Platforms must integrate reliable age-verification solutions, which typically rely on centralized databases, biometric checks, or government-issued digital IDs. These systems introduce cybersecurity considerations around data storage, potential breach risks, and the scalability of cloud resources needed to process millions of verification requests daily. Infrastructure providers may see increased demand for secure, compliant hosting environments.
